Special Delivery from the North Pole

The November 2018 Paper Pumpkin was really cute including the plaid envelopes they provided! Well - I could not let all of the cuteness go to waste - so I had to cut apart the envelope to utilize the cute plaid within. When I did that, there was this weird extra triangular piece left over and try as I might - every time I used it it sill ended up looking like an envelope - so I gave in & said - let me just make an envelope AS the card. So I went off to my stash to find an across the miles type sentiment & came across the Special Delivery from the North Pole - perfect!!! This is a typical A2 top fold card.

The card front is made from 2 pieces of the leftover cut apart envelope. I highlighted the seam of the envelope with a marker to get more of the point across that it is an envelope and mounted that on the enclosed card base in the Paper Pumpkin kit..
